On this episode, Dr. Robin Stern delves into a story that unearths the chilling depths of gaslighting, the indomitable strength of the human spirit, and the power of inspiration.

Robin's guest, Collier Landry, has navigated a path marked by the most unthinkable circumstances. Collier's story is a harrowing tale of a murder that rocked his world and the insidious web of gaslighting that ensnared him.

Collier is the central figure in the documentary "A Murder In Mansfield," produced by Collier and directed by Barbara Kopple.

The film centers around the murder of Noreen Boyle, Collier Landry's mother, which took place in Mansfield Ohio in 1989. At the time Collier was a young boy who had been a witness to his mother's murder, and his testimony played a crucial role in the trial of his father, Dr. John Boyle, who was accused and ultimately convicted of the crime.

Robin and Collier unravel the layers of his story, his unwavering courage in the face of manipulation, and the profound inspiration he offers to all who have faced the darkness of gaslighting. His resilience is a testament to the human capacity for healing and growth, even in the wake of the most haunting challenges.

Be prepared to be both moved and empowered by this transformative episode with Collier Landry. His story shines a light on the courage it takes to confront the demons of manipulation and emerge as an inspiration to others.
